Everest's Fury: Daring Rescue Saves Hikers from Treacherous Snowstorm

A severe snowstorm, an unexpected and brutal assailant, recently descended upon the majestic yet unforgiving slopes of Mount Everest, trapping a group of unprepared hikers in its icy grip. What began as a challenging yet exhilarating trek quickly transformed into a desperate battle for survival, prompting a large-scale, daring rescue operation that captivated the world.

The storm, characterized by whiteout conditions, plummeting temperatures, and relentless blizzards, struck with little warning, leaving trekkers and climbers stranded at various high-altitude camps.

Reports from the region painted a grim picture: visibility reduced to near zero, pathways obliterated by fresh snow, and the very air becoming a weapon against those exposed to its raw power. Many individuals, caught off guard, faced immediate threats of hypothermia, frostbite, and acute mountain sickness as conditions deteriorated rapidly.

As distress calls began to filter through, Nepali authorities, alongside experienced local Sherpa guides and international rescue teams, immediately mobilized.

The treacherous weather made aerial operations incredibly risky, yet the urgency of the situation demanded swift action. Helicopters, piloted by seasoned aviators, braved the swirling snow and thin air, attempting to pinpoint the locations of the stranded individuals.

On the ground, brave Sherpas, renowned for their unparalleled knowledge of the mountain and their incredible resilience, spearheaded rescue efforts.

These heroes navigated perilous terrain, battling against the ferocious winds and deep snowdrifts to reach those in need. Their intimate understanding of Everest's contours and their unwavering courage proved instrumental in locating and assisting hikers who were rapidly losing hope.

The rescue mission unfolded over several intense hours, a testament to human fortitude and cooperation in the face of nature's wrath.

Many hikers, some suffering from varying degrees of frostbite and severe exhaustion, were successfully evacuated to safety. The relief felt by the rescued, and indeed by their families anxiously awaiting news, was palpable, a stark contrast to the terror they had endured just hours before.

This incident serves as a powerful reminder of the inherent dangers and unpredictable nature of high-altitude mountaineering, even for seemingly well-prepared expeditions.

Mount Everest, while beckoning with its unparalleled beauty and challenge, demands the utmost respect and vigilance. The successful rescue operation stands as a tribute to the indomitable spirit of the rescue teams and the enduring hope that can prevail even in the most extreme circumstances.
